About the Role
Join a specialist team dedicated to creating safer, healthier indoor environments. We are an emerging leader in the treatment of mould, damp, and indoor contamination. This isn't just a job; it's a technical role where you will learn to identify building defects, address root causes, and install advanced preventative solutions against mould, bacteria and viruses.
Full training will be provided and you do not need to have any previous experience for Technician role, just have an eagerness to learn, self-develop and promote excellent customer care. Some of this work may be in confined spaces and a good level of fitness is required. Advanced Technicians will bring related previous experience.

Key Responsibilities
- Conducting onsite remediation of mould-damaged properties.
- Installing specialist products to improve indoor air quality and prevent contamination.
- Identifying damp and mould building defects and implementing provided technical solutions.
- Maintaining high standards of cleanliness and professionalism while working in residential and commercial properties.
Requirements
- Attributes: A strong "growth mindset" and a genuine eagerness to learn new, niche skills.
- Physicality: Good level of fitness (work involves physical labour and occasionally confined spaces).
- Travel: Must have a clean UK driving licence and be fully flexible for UK-wide travel, including overnight stays.
- Soft Skills: Good communication skills and a conscientious, presentable manner.
